AN AUXILIARY BLEED AIR SYSTEM CAN REACH UP TO WHAT PRESSURE?

125 PSI
WHAT IS ICE THAT IS SMOOTH AND HARD TO DETECT VISUALLY?

GLAZED ICE
WHAT IS ICE THAT IS ROUGH AND EASILY NOTICED?

RIME
WHAT IS FORMED AS A RESULT OF WATER VAPOR BEING TURNED DIRECTLY INTO A SOLID?

FROST
WHAT DOES THE P-3 AIRCRAFT USE TO VISUALLY WARN THE PILOT OF ICING CONDITIONS AND WHERE IS THE WARNING LIGHT INSTALLED?

ICE DETECTOR SYSTEM


CENTER INSTRUMENT PANEL

HOW MANY ANTI-ICING MODULATING VALVES DOES THE P-3 HAVE INSTALLED IN EACH WING?

THREE
P-3 ANTI-ICING VALVES ARE _____ CONTROLLED AND _____ OPERATED.


THERMOSTATICALLY


PNEUMATICALLY

THERMOSTATS IN THE OUTBOARD LEADING EDGE PLENUM AREAS ARE SET AT ___ F. THE WING INBOARD AND CENTER SECTION THERMOSTATS ARE SET AT ___ F.


145


120

DESCRIBE THE DIFFERENCE BETWEEN ANTI-ICING AND DEICING SYSTEM.
AN ANTI-ICING SYSTEM IS DESIGNED TO PREVENT ICE FROM FORMING ON THE AIRCRAFT. A DEICING SYSTEM IS DESIGNED TO REMOVE ICE AFTER IT HAS FORMED.
IN AN ANTI-ICE SYSTEM, WHAT METHODS ARE USED TO REMOVE ICE FORMATION?

ELECTRICAL HEATERS


HOT AIR


COMBINATION OF BOTH

ON AN EA-6B, THE WINDSHIELD WASHING TANK HOLDS ___ GALLONS OF WASHING FLUID.

1 1/2
DESCRIBE THE MIXUTRE CONTENT ON AN EA-6B WINDSHIELD-WASHER SYSTEM.
50% WATER-MTHYL ALCOHOL MIXTURE
WHAT TYPE OF VALVE IS THE WINDSHIELD-WASHING SHUTOFF VALVE?
SOLENOID-OPERATED VALVE

WHAT EVENT TAKES PLACE IF THE PRESSURE IN THE WINDSHIELD-WASHING TANK GOES ABOVE 13 +/- .5 PSIG?
THE RELIEF VALVE INSIDE THE WINDSHIELD-WASHING SHUTOFF VALVE OPENS AND PRESSURE IS REDUCED
WHAT IS THE CAPACITY OF THE WINDSHIELD-WASHING TANK?
1 1/2 GALLONS
IDENTIFY THE PURPOSE OF AN ANTI-G SYSTEM.
REDUCES THE FATIGUING EFFECT OF REPEATED EXPOSURE TO POSITIVE OR NEGATIVE G FORCES, ALSO PROVIDES A METHOD BY WHICH THE CREWMEMBER CAN RELIEVE FATIGUE AND PHYSICAL TENSION DURING EXTENDED FLIGHT
MOST ANTI-G SYSTEMS CONSIST OF WHAT COMPONENTS?

ANTI-G VALVE


ANTI-G SYSTEM FILTER


QUICK DISCONNECTS

THE ANTI-G VALVE REGULATES HIGH-PRESSURE BLEED AIR TO WHAT MAXIMUM PRESSURE FOR DELIVERY TO THE G-SUIT?
10 PSI
DESCRIBE THE OPERATION OF AM ANTI-G SYSTEM.
AS HIGH G FORCES OCCUR, THE ANTI-G VALVES ACTIVATING WEIGHT IS FORCED DOWN TO CLOSE THE EXHAUST AND OPEN THE DEMAND VALVE.
A VENT-AIR SYSTEM IS USED FOR WHAT PURPOSE?
PROVIDES A MEASURE OF PERSONAL COMFORT, OFFSETTING THE DISCOMFORT CAUSED BY THE WEARING OF THE ANTI EXPOSURE SUIT OR HEAT CREATED BY COCKPIT EQUIPMENT AND RESULTING HIGH TEMPERATURE AMBIENT

WHERE IS THE VENT SUIT TEMPERATURE SENSOR LOCATED?
IN A MNAIFOLD DOWNSTREAM OF THE VENT SUIT TEMPERATURE VALVE

DESCRIBE THE PURPOSE OF THE F-18 AIRCRAFT RADAR LIQUID COOLING SYSTEM.
CIRCULATES LIQUID COOLANT TO REMOVE HEAT FROM THE RADAR TRANSMITTER HIGH-VOLTAGE RF ENERGY MODULES.
DURING GORUND OPERATION, WHAT COMPONENT SUPPLIES COOLING AIR FOR THE HEAT EXCHANGER?
GROUND COOLING FAN
NAME THE EIGHT MAJOR COMPONENTS OF THE RADAR LIQUID COOLING SYSTEM.

LIQUID TO AIR HEAT EXCHANGER


LIQUID COOLANT PUMP


AIRFLOW VALVE


GROUND COOLING FAN


COOLANT SYSTEM FILTER


LOW PRESSURE SENSOR


HIGH TEMPERATURE SENSOR


COOLANT TEMPERATURE SENSOR


DESCRIBE THE OPERATION OF THE GROUND COOLING FAN.
THE GROUND COOLING FAN IS ELECTRICALLY POWERED AND SUPPLIES A FLOW OF AMBIENT AIR FOR HEAT TRANSFER FROM THE LIQUID HEAT EXCHANGER DURING AIRCRAFT GROUND OPERATIONS
WHAT IS CF3BR?

TRIFLOUROBROMOMETHANE
WHAT IS THE MOST COMMON EXTINGUISHING AGENT USED IN AIRCRAFT FIRE-EXTINGUISHING SYSTEMS?

CF3BR
THE P-3 FIRE-EXTINGUISHING SYSTEM CONTROLS FIRES WITHIN ____ ENGINE NACELLES AND EQUIPPED WITH ____ INDEPENDENT ELECTRICALLY CONTROLLED FIRE SYSTEM.


FOUR


TWO

EACH CONTAINER IS PRESSURIZED TO _____ PSI AND CHARGED WITH ____ POUNDS OF EXTINGUISHING AGENT.


600


10.5

UNDER NORMAL ATMOSPHERIC PRESSURE AND TEMPERATURE, DESCRIBE THE CHARACTERISTICS OF CF3BR.
IT IS A MORE EFFICIENT EXTINGUISHING SYSTEM THAN CO2 AND UNDER NORMAL ATMOSPHERIC PRESSURE AND TEMPERATURE, IT IS ODORLESS AND TASTELESS
HOW MANY INDEPENDENT FIRE-EXTINGUISHING SYSTEMS DOES A P-3 AIRCRAFT USE?
TWO
LIST THE DIFFERENT PORTS FOR A TRANSFER CHECK VALVE.
TWO INLET PORTS AND ONE OUTLET PORT, AND A POPPET THAT SHUTS OFF THE INLET PORT

WHAT IS THE INTERNAL VOLUME OF A P-3 FIRE EXTINGUISHER CONTAINER?
400 (+200, -15) CUBIC INCHES
AVIONICS PRESSURIZATION ASSEMBLY REMOVES 100 PERCENT OF PARTICLES LARGER THAN ___ MICRONS AND 98 PERCENT OF PARTICLES LARGER THAN ___ MICRONS.

25


10


DESCRIBE THE PURPOSE OF AN AUXILIARY POWER UNIT FIRE DETECTION AND EXTINGUISHING SYSTEM.
PROVIDES DETECTION AND EXTINGUISHING FOR THE APU COMPARTMENT ON THE GROUND AND IN FLIGHT.

WHAT IS/ARE INDICATIONS GIVE IF A FIRE IS PRESENT IN THE APU?
A HORN SOUNDS AND A WARNING LIGHT ILLUMINATES.
WHERE ARE THE TWO WAVEGUIDE AIR DESICATORS LOCATED?
DOWNSTREAM FROM THE WAVEGUIDE FLUID PRESSURE REGULATING VALVES
WHAT ARE THE WAVEGUIDE AIR DESICATORS USED FOR?

ECM AND RADAR
WHAT IS THE PURPOSE OF AN F-18 WAVEGUIDE PRESSURIZATION SYSTEM?
TO CONTAIN AND TRANSPORT THE REGULATED, FILTERED, DRY AIR TO THE RADAR AND ECM WAVEGUIDE CAVATIES
WHAT PERCENTAGE OF PARTICLES WILL THE FILTER ASSEMBLY REMOVE IF THEY ARE 25 MICRONS OR LARGER?
100%

THE WAVEGUIDE PRESSURE REGULATING VALVE HAS HOW MANY ANEROID ASSEMBLIES TO REGULATE AIR PRESSURE?
TWO
DESCRIBE THE PURPOSE OF THE MISSILE COOLING SYSTEM.
TO PROVIDE THERMAL CONDITIONING FOR THE RADAR SYSTEM OF THE WCS AND MISSILE
WHAT IS THE PURPOSE OF THE MISSILE HOT AIR MODULATING VALVE?
THE VALVE HEATS THE COOLANT DURING SYSTEM WARM UP

THE COOLANT PUMP CIRCULATES WHAT AMOUNT OF COOLANT PER MINUTE?

18 GALLONS

WHAT TYPE OF PROTECTIVE MEASURES MUST YOU TAKE WHEN SERVICING THE MISSILE LIQUID COOLING SYSTEM?
RESPIRATOR OR AM AREA WITH FORCED VENTILATION, AND CHEMICAL SPLASH PROOF GOGGLES AND GLOVE
PRIOR TO TAKING A COOLANT SAMPLE, THE COOLANT MUST HAVE CIRCULATED FOR WHAT AMOUNT OF TIME?
5 MINUTES
